Cookies
Our website uses so-called cookies. These are small text files that are stored on your end device with the help of the browser. They do not cause any damage. We use cookies to make our website more user-friendly. Some cookies remain stored on your device until you delete them. They enable us to recognize your browser on your next visit. If you do not want this, you can set up your browser so that it informs you about the setting of cookies and you only allow this in individual cases. If cookies are deactivated, the functionality of our website may be restricted and have a negative impact on the appearance and your user experience.
Technically necessary cookies (cannot be deselected)
Necessary and functional cookies are absolutely essential for the website to function properly. This category only includes cookies that ensures basic functionalities and security features of the website. These cookies do not store any personal information. These include session cookies, which are created automatically and which increase the security of communication between the server and client, as well as the cookie settings themselves, which save the cookie settings that have been set. Another category is functional cookies, which you can deactivate via your browser. However, they affect certain functions such as accessing protected pages (login handling) or the proper functioning of a web store.
Non-necessary cookies (consent required)
Any cookies that may not be particularly necessary for the website to function and is used specifically to collect user personal data via analytics, ads, other embedded contents are termed as non-necessary cookies. For example, targeted cookies (e.g. analysis tools), marketing cookies (delivery of targeted advertising) or social media widgets (loading images, videos directly from the social media provider, which leads to the exchange of data with this network). This requires your mandatory consent, which is displayed when you activate the button.
The legal basis for the processing of personal data using cookies is Art. 6 para. 1/a GDPR for consent-related cookies.
Web analysis with Matomo
We use the open source software tool Matomo on our website, which was set up on a virtual server of the data center Hetzner Online GmbH, Sigmundstraße 135, 90431 Nuremberg, Germany. This ensures that no data is transmitted to third parties and that the data remains under our control. Matomo uses cookies. These cookies allow us to count visits. These text files are stored on your computer and enable us to analyze the use of our website. The last two character blocks of your IP address are marked, so we have no technical way of uniquely identifying you as a user. We understand this analysis as part of an Internet service in order to be able to further improve the website and adapt it even better to the needs of users. With the cookie content when using our website for the first time, you have the option of agreeing whether a web analysis cookie may be stored in your browser to enable us to collect and analyze statistical data.

SSL encryption
This site uses SSL encryption for security reasons and to protect the transmission of confidential content, such as the requests you send to us as the site operator. You can recognize an encrypted connection by the fact that the address line of the browser changes from “http://” to “https://” and by the lock symbol in your browser line. If SSL encryption is activated, the data you transmit to us cannot be read by third parties.
